矩阵的奇异值分解在红外光谱预处理中的应用
Application of SVD Denoising in the Preprocessing of Infrared Spectrum

Abstract
The application of SVD denoising was studied in the preprocessing of infrared spectrum. The principle of largest spacing and maximum peak was adopted to choose effective rank order. The original spectrum was preprocessed by SVD denoising and the first derivative, the wave wand were selected with the method of correlation coefficient. Calibration mod-el for kinematic viscosity was established using the PLS method, and was compared with convolution smoothing. Its R c was 0.9779, its SEC was 0.1005, its Rp was 0.9412, its SEP was 0.1547. The results showed that SVD and the first derivative could effectively conduct denoising, correct baseline drift and improve the accuracy of PLS model.关键词
